LBF Chapter 10 First Love
"Why, are you happy to see me?" The woman's eyes narrowed as she posed the question.
"Why should I? We are only acquaintances." Damien answered nonchalantly. The arrival of this woman had taken away his nostalgic feelings so he took a step, bypassed her, and continued into the distance.
"Damien Okoye! Do you think that you are some big shot? Why do you always ignore me?" The woman shouted at the top of her voice upon turning around. Being ignored had offended her, and as a result, she shouted, causing the dark matter to ripple.
"Who made it this way, hmmm?" Damien paused for a second upon hearing her question and posed one of himself, causing her expression to warp, but she failed at a retort.
He continued on his way upon finishing his piece. Every step he took, sending him countless kilometers away.
"Why are you following me?" He asked after a few seconds. She was walking just a few meters behind him.
"We are heading in the same direction. I will stick with you until the end." She answered playfully.
"Were you always this shameless?" He frowned once again.
"Yes. This time, I know what I want and am never going to let you slip away ever again." She giggled happily.
"Weren't you the one who terminated our relationship back then?" Damien turned around abruptly and asked. Rage was creeping in his voice. Miss Darkness stopped a meter from him. His crimson eyes stared into hers with such intensity that she literally felt as if she was about to be scorched into oblivion. She had no choice but to look away, lacking any words to hurl back at him.
"What did you say back then? Let me enlighten you...you said something about us being from two different worlds and that Larry, a demigod at the time was the only one qualified to be with you." Damien crossed his hands over his chest and looked at her with condescension and mockery.

Miss Darkness was the daughter of that legend of a god, she was dearly loved by him, and she never lacked any resources ever since she had been born. She was born at five strings, gods could at least ensure that their descendants weren't born any lower than that. They met at that level, but the father disagreed. He had seen many five elemental string beings stuck at that level, never making it past, so he chose Larry, a demigod at the time as her partner.
"That was in the past. Can't you please let it go?" She asked almost shedding tears.
"You...were the first woman I loved." That came out as a statement, without any emotions attached to it. The passage of time had eroded away any feelings that might have been connected. Darkness felt the lack of emotions and she felt a weight settle at the bottom of her heart.
"I was still young and naive then. Could you give me a second chance?" She implored.
"If it had been a normal break up, them probably yes, but you trampled on my pride and feelings." He answered emotionlessly.
"Could you leave me alone...this is a request from me." He asked sincerely.
"Did you fall for someone else?" She asked as if she was hoping for something.
"Does that matter?" Her expression sank at that question.
"Actually I have you to thank for my current life. If I had stuck with you, I would probably never made it to the level of a demigod."
"Right now, I want to become a God and marry many goddesses." He continued. She was the only person capable of eliciting this many words from him.
"I will be leaving for Pantheon city right away. I hope we never meet again." He said.

"But what am I supposed to do with all these feelings I have?" She shouted. His words had made her feel as if a chasm had appeared between them. She didn't want that to happen.
"I heard that you got married. I am not into the habit of playing the adultery game." He refused still.
"We...divorced."
"Oh...really!" That came out as sacarstic. He even had a grin on his face.
"Don't mock me!" She shouted with a red face.
"I found out some years into the marriage that all he wanted was to get close to my father. He didn't really love me."
"Oh! I never knew that he was ambitious. He's still trash though. He can't see the bigger picture." He insulted the man.
Most marriages in the galaxy came about as a means to tie yourself to a powerful clan, or to give birth to a child stronger or equal to you in strength.
That's why Damien felt that the guy was short sighted. He should have tried to have a child with her.
"All the times, that we were together. He couldn't stop yapping about my dad this...my dad that. It was tiresome!" She complained.
"Well...your divorce doesn't interest me." Seeing that she was bout to continue with the complaints, he turned around and continued on his way to Earth.
"Lily! So this was where you were." Another voice, apart from theirs reverberated through the void. It felt warm.
The voice caused Damien to stop in place and sigh in exasperation.
'Earth has produced four demigods in this era, why did it have to be that I became deeply involved with two of them!' His eyes narrowed. It didn't just stop there, he even developed a bit of killing intent.
A green light lit up the void in front of them and a whirlpool formed out of countless green particles popped into existence.
Damien, who was closest to it even felt his divinity jump about a little in his heart. Even the blood flowing through his veins became lively.
Some of the green particles at the outer edges of the whirlpool created various images of flora, as if they were trying to make plant life appear in this lifeless void.
'He hasn't been slacking off it seems.' He frowned.
A man walked out of the whirlpool. He was slim...the word beanpole appropriate to describe him. He had blonde short hair, blue eyes and he was dressed in such a way that he appeared to be a mage. A green crystalline wooden staff was in his hand. All he lacked was a pointy hat to complete the entire ensemble.
His blue pupils were contemptuous as they beheld Damien within them, but they instantly turned kind when they moved into Miss Darkness, real name being Lily.
"Lily my dear, how can you throw the divorce papers at me with just a tiny disagreement?" He asked patiently.
'What a shameless...' Damien shook his head before continuing his journey towards Earth.
"Larry, don't be shameless and clingy. We should end it..."
The conversation faded as he continuously put distance between them. He put the previous encounter to the back of his mind when the planet entered his eyes.
